Shibile is a SaaS/enterprise software platform for professional content publishing and learning scenarios. Based on the information on its pages, it primarily serves Publishers, Authors, Students, and Professionals, with a particular emphasis on highly specialized “high-stakes domains” such as surgery and engineering. Its core proposition is to help publishers produce, protect, and sell professional content under their own brands, while giving learners a smoother learning and purchasing experience.
In terms of functionality, Shibile is structured around three layers. The first is Sovereign Storefronts, where publishers can build branded content storefronts and access tools for content creation, protection, and sales. The second is Frictionless Experience, offering students and professionals a unified learning hub, social login, one-click checkout, and interactive communities. The third is Global Marketplace, namely “Mooltiverse,” which connects authors with publishers and expands content reach through AI translation and cross-border distribution agreements. Its strengths are its focused positioning and fit for high-value professional knowledge content. It is not just a simple course-hosting tool, but covers branded storefronts, learner experience, and global distribution. AI translation and cross-border distribution may also be attractive to professional publishers. The drawbacks are also clear: public information is limited, especially around security and compliance, copyright protection mechanisms, payment methods, permission management, APIs, customer case studies, and service support. For high-risk sectors such as healthcare and engineering, these details directly affect procurement decisions.
Shibile is better suited to publishers, author organizations, or vertical education teams with professional content assets that want to build their own branded sales channels and explore international distribution.
